IDFC First reports Rs 590cr fraud in Haryana govt a/c; bank suspends 4 employees pending probe

MUMBAI: IDFC First Bank has reported a Rs 590-crore discrepancy in deposits held on behalf of Haryana govt at its Chandigarh branch, and suspended four employees pending investigation.The bank’s filing comes after the state directed its departments to close accounts with private lenders on Feb 18. Section 301: How USTR polices trade partners

After the setback on tariffs in the US Supreme Court, US president Donald Trump indicated that he would order section 301 investigations against trading partners.
